ABOUT LARRY FLEET
Country singer and songwriter known for the 2021 single "Where I find God." In 2017, country singer Jake Owen discovered him performing cover songs at a wedding. Owen booked him as an opening act. In 2019, he signed with Big Loud.
At age six, he started playing guitar and performing in his family's bluegrass band, Happy Two. He played at The Wet Bar in Dickson, Tennessee. He also played at a bar called Evolutions.
He worked as a radio promoter and electrician to support himself. He competed on the USA Network's competition series Real Country, where Owen served as a judge. He placed second on the show.
He and his wife have a son named Waylon. His great-uncle taught him how to play guitar and fiddle.
His musical influences include Willie Nelson , Otis Redding , Merle Haggard and The Temptations .
